Super Sentai Artisan DX Won Tiger Revealed

Posted on November 22, 2017 at 12:04 pm by Kiryu under Super Sentai

Following the release of Super Sentai Artisan DX Rairen’Oh last year Bandai teased us with the prospect of an Artisan Won Tiger release, and that piece has fully been revealed in the latest issue of Figure Oh magazine.

Of course, Super Sentai Artisan DX Won Tiger is fully capable of combining with the aforementioned Dairen’Oh. Also included are seven Treasure Perals which can be swapped out.  All of this will cost 14,400 yen as a P-Bandai release.

Gosei Sentai Dairanger DVDs Announced by Shout! Factory

Posted on July 11, 2015 at 12:09 am by Den-O under Super Sentai

In a similar fashion to last years Kyoryu Sentai Zyuranger news, the fine people at Shout! Factory have just dropped another bombshell on the tokusatsu fandom. When asked by a fan in the audience at tonight’s San Diego Comic Con 2015 panel, “Will we get a new tokusatsu title?” they were able to reply yes. And that title is Gosei Sentai Dairanger!

Fans in the west will undoubtedly recognize the footage from this show as it was utilized for Mighty Morphin Power Rangers Season 2 as well as the character Kiba Ranger who was adapted as the Mighty Morphin White Ranger. Still yet people may recall the “new powers” of Power Rangers Super Megaforce where the Dairanger suits were shown on American TV for the first time.

For now it’s safe to assume that this DVD set will follow the same formula as Shouts Zyuranger DVDs at a similar price point for  the entire series in one set.

Yutaka Kiba Ranger Role Play Set Gallery

Posted on April 3, 2014 at 12:28 pm by Toku Chris under Power Rangers, Super Sentai

Here’s a blast out of the past brought to you by our photo guru conundrum! It only seems fitting that with the Mighty Morphin White Power Ranger in the final round of Morphin Madness that we feature this…interesting…figure from the days of Gosei Sentai Dairanger. Behold, the Yutaka Kiba Ranger Role Play set!

For those asking, “What the F is Yutaka?” … Yutaka was a branch of Bandai of Japan formed from the remnants of Shinsei Manufacturing created in 1990 and closed down back in 2003. Their primary focus was cost-affordable role play items for the Super Sentai and Kamen Rider series in Japan. This gallery is of Kiba Ranger from Gosei Sentai Dairanger, or better known to the rest of the world as the Mighty Morphin White Power Ranger.

While not the most eloquent looking figure with very limited articulation (it still might rival ToQOh though…), the sculpting on Byakkoshinken (aka Saba) looks very impressive. Rare Behind-The-Scenes Footage of Dairanger Revealed!

Posted on December 15, 2013 at 6:38 pm by Paladin under Super Sentai

Jeff Pruit, a director and stunt coordinator for early Power Rangers episodes, has released some video footage of the filming of Dairanger (recorded in preparation for Mighty Morphin Power Rangers Season 2).

This gives us some incredibly rare firsthand looks at the extensive work that goes into filming a Super Sentai series, examining everything from suit work to stunt filming!
